Living in Starks means we understand a few things about our environment that directly impact our dogs. Our sweltering summers aren't just tough on us—they're a genuine concern for our pets. A quality local **dog daycare** won't just have a fenced yard; they'll have a climate-controlled indoor play area for those 95-degree afternoons with 90% humidity, ensuring playtime is safe and cool. They'll also understand the importance of shade, plenty of fresh water, and maybe even a kiddie pool for a good, muddy splash—because let's face it, a dirty dog is sometimes a happy dog!
Beyond the heat, we know our area is rich with wildlife and dense foliage. A great daycare facility will prioritize safety with secure, reinforced fencing to prevent any adventurous chases after a squirrel or, heaven forbid, a curious raccoon. It's peace of mind knowing your dog can socialize and romp in a protected environment while you're taking care of business.
So, what should you look for when choosing a **dog daycare** here in Starks? First, ask about their screening process. Do they require meet-and-greets or vaccinations? This ensures every pup in their care is healthy and well-matched for playgroups. Inquire about their daily schedule—is there a balance of active play and mandatory nap times? A tired dog is a happy dog, but an overstimulated one isn't. Don't hesitate to ask for a tour; a transparent facility will be proud to show you their clean, organized space.
